K. Suguri et al., A REAL-TIME MOTION ESTIMATION AND COMPENSATION LSI WITH WIDE SEARCH RANGE FOR MPEG2 VIDEO ENCODING, IEEE journal of solid-state circuits, 31(11), 1996, pp. 1733-1741
This paper presents a motion estimation and compensation large scale i
ntegration (LSI) for the MPEG2 standard. An embedded RISC processor an
d special hardware modules enable the LSI to achieve a sufficient abil
ity to perform realtime operation and provide the availability to real
ize many kinds of block matching algorithms. Using a three-step hierar
chical telescopic search algorithm, a single chip accomplishes real-ti
me motion estimation with search ranges of +/- 32.5 x +/- 32.5 pixels
for motion vectors. The chip was fabricated using 0.5-mu m CMOS techno
logy and has an area of 16.5 x 16.5 mm(2) and 2.0 M transistors.
